Career Assessment Workshops
These are workshops designed to introduce first year students to
the concept of self-assessment for best occupational match. Students
pre-take a Holland-based self-assessment and bring their results to
small group workshops where they share their results and are
introduced to the basics of Holland’s theory, and its applicability
to their occupational choice. These workshops have been a required
piece of Psychology 101 courses, and in the near future, will also
encompass University 101, and Communications 101 but any student can
attend. There are multiple workshops offered at different times
throughout the week both semesters.
